algorithme de tri à bulle
TP 7 Algorithmes de tri
Le tri à bulles est un algorithme de tri classique Son principe est simple et il est très facile à implémenter On considère un tableau de nombres T |
La complexité temporelle du tri à bulles est O(n^2).
Cela signifie que le nombre d'opérations nécessaires pour trier un tableau de n éléments augmente de façon exponentielle à mesure que la taille du tableau augmente.
Pour les petits tableaux, le tri à bulles peut être un algorithme efficace.
Quel est l'algorithme de tri ?
Un algorithme de tri est, en informatique ou en mathématiques, un algorithme qui permet d'organiser une collection d'objets selon une relation d'ordre déterminée.
Les objets à trier sont des éléments d'un ensemble muni d'un ordre total.
Quel est l'algorithme de tri le plus rapide ?
Le tri rapide - aussi appelé "tri de Hoare" (du nom de son inventeur Tony Hoare) ou "tri par segmentation" ou "tri des bijoutiers" ou, en anglais "quicksort" - est certainement l'algorithme de tri interne le plus efficace.
TP 7 Algorithmes de tri
Le tri à bulles est un algorithme de tri classique. Son principe est simple et il est très facile à implémenter. On considère un tableau de nombres T |
Fiche-tri-selection-bulles-insertion.pdf
Ce critère est en effet une relation d'ordre total sur les éléments à trier. La conception d'un algorithme de tri dépend du support matériel de la séquence de |
Algorithmes de tri interne [tr] (3) Méthodes par échanges
Une méthode naıve conduit `a l'algorithme du « tri bulles ». Une autre bulle puis `a trier récursivement un tableau de n−1 éléments. Si C(n) désigne le ... |
Complexité (tri à bulle)
La complexité d'un algorithme est la fonction mathématique qui décrit en fonction de la taille des données d'entrées (par exemple le nombre de mots) |
Vous avez dit trier ? 1 - algorithmes simples
tri d'un jeu de cartes le tri à bulle dont le principe est assez simple |
Introduction à lalgorithmique et la complexité (et un peu de CAML
Tri à Bulles. Tri Fusion. Faire mieux ? Outline. 1. Algorithme de Tri par Sélection. 2. Algorithme de Tri par Insertion. 3. Algorithme de Tri à Bulles. 4. |
LIFAP3 : Algorithmique et programmation procédurale
Le tableau est donc bien trié de 0 à n-1 (et il ne reste rien à trier) ce qui prouve que l'algorithme de tri est correct. Tri à bulles. Le tri à bulles est un |
ALGORITHMES DE TRI
- Algorithme de tri par insertion. Pour terminer pour aller plus loin |
Tri à Bulles bidirectionnel(cocktail shaker) Tri par insertion (utilisant
Le tri bidirectionnel ou cocktail shaker est une variante de l'algorithme du tri à bulles. Il consiste à parcourir le tableau de gauche à droite. puis de |
Chapitre 4 : Les algorithmes de tri
8.5 – Tri à bulles. • Optimisation de l'algorithme (si temps suffisant). – Après avoir traité i-1 éléments (1 ≤ i ≤ n). • Les éléments de 1..i-1 sont triés. |
TP 7 Algorithmes de tri
particulier les algorithmes de tri par insertion et tri à bulles déjà vus en première année puis l'algorithme de tri rapide (quicksort). 1 Tri à bulles. |
Trier un tableau 1 Exercices
Question 2 Implantez cet algorithme pour réaliser une procédure qui trie par cette méthode le tableau passé en paramètre. Exercice 4-2 Tri à bulle. |
Complexité du tri à Bulles
Complexité du tri à Bulles. Algorithme du tri à Bulles. Version non optimisée : void bubbleSort(int tab[] int n). { int j; bool permutation = true;. |
Leçon 903 : Exemples dalgorithmes de tri. Correction et complexité
Algorithm 3 Algorithme du tri par dénombrement. 1: function Tri-Bulle(A). > A : tableau à trier. 2:. |
Complexité (tri à bulle)
La complexité d'un algorithme est la fonction mathématique qui décrit en fonction de la taille des données d'entrées (par exemple le nombre de mots) |
Fiche-tri-selection-bulles-insertion.pdf
La conception d'un algorithme de tri dépend du support matériel de la séquence de valeurs à trier (en mémoire centrale ou sur une mémoire secondaire). |
Introduction à lalgorithmique et la complexité (et un peu de CAML
Algorithmes de Tri (et leur complexité). Nicolas Nisse Algorithme de tri à bulles : comparer répétitivement les éléments consécutifs d'un. |
Sorting Algorithms
Les algorithmes de tri présentés dans ce document sont soit : - élémentaires : tri à bulles tri par sélection |
Corrigé de la séance Python 2 (algorithmes de tri) 1 Tri bulle
"""trie la liste l par l'algorithme du tri bulle. 3. La fonction modifie la liste l et ne renvoie rien""". 4. |
Chapitre 4 : Les algorithmes de tri
tableau vide est trié. – tableau ne contenant qu'un seul élément est trié important cet algorithme requiert ... Le principe du tri à bulles (bubble. |
Leçon 903 : Exemples dalgorithmes de tri Correction et - Index of
Algorithm 3 Algorithme du tri par dénombrement 1: function Tri-Bulle(A) > A : tableau à trier 2: |
Les algorithmes de tri - Luc Brun
Définition d'un algorithme de tri, Le tri par minimum successifs, Le tri a bulles, Le tri rapide Les algorithmes de recherche Recherche séquentielle non triée |
Trier un tableau 1 Exercices
Question 2 Implantez cet algorithme pour réaliser une procédure qui trie par cette méthode le tableau passé en paramètre Exercice 4-2 Tri à bulle L'algorithme |
Les méthodes de tri
Le tri à bulle consiste à parcourir le tableau, par exemple de gauche à droite, en comparant les éléments La stratégie de cet algorithme est comme suit : 1 |
21 Tri à Bulles - Infoscience - EPFL
Un sujet majeur d'algorithmique est le tri d'objets tels que les tableaux Le choix du meilleur algorithme pour une tache particulière peut être un processus |
Algorithmes de tri
Exercice 3 Dans l'algorithme du tri `a bulle, 1 montrez qu'apr`es k parcours du tableau (boucle interne), au moins k éléments sont `a leur place, 2 déduisez-en |
Algorithmes de tri interne [tr] (3) Méthodes par échanges - Unisciel
naıve conduit `a l'algorithme du « tri bulles » Une autre, beaucoup plus élaborée , don- nera le « tri rapide » qui est un algorithme par segmentation appliquant |
Mesures de performance – exemple des tris Les tris - LIPN
La plupart des algorithmes Le principe de l'algorithme est le suivant : on cherche dans le tableau le plus grand élément Le tri à bulles n'est pas très efficace |
1 Préparation 2 Tri à bulles
L'objectif de ce TP est de (re)programmer quelques algorithmes de tri Programmez l'algorithme du tri à bulle sur des tableaux de type PERMUTATION Q5 |